Q: Is 31,031,014 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 31,031,014 is a composite number.

Why is 31,031,014 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 31,031,014 can be evenly divided by 1 2 7 14 41 49 82 98 287 574 2,009 4,018 7,723 15,446 54,061 108,122 316,643 378,427 633,286 756,854 2,216,501 4,433,002 15,515,507 and 31,031,014, with no remainder.

Since 31,031,014 cannot be divided by just 1 and 31,031,014, it is a composite number.
